    Quote Originally Posted by stuart1980 View Post
    If I want to change just say one thing on the website in future, which files do I transfer - just the relevant page .htm file? I don't touch the index_htm_files folder?
    In Xara, just make whatever change you want to make and make sure the little box in at the bottom of the Publish tab is checked

    In Filezilla, you can use Synchronized Browsing

    If you have an identical directory structure on the local machine and the server, you can enable synchronized browsing. This means that any directory navigation on one machine is duplicated on the other.

    To enable synchronized browsing, create an entry in the Site Manager, and on the Advanced tab, ensure that the Default local directory and the Default remote directory have the same structure. Then check "use synchronized browsing," save your settings, and connect.

    Or you can use Directory Comparison

    To quickly see differences between files on the local machine and the server, choose View > Directory Comparison, and choose either "compare file size" or "compare modification time." (You also hide identical files by checking that option.) Then choose "Enable."

    You will now see colour-coded differences between copies of the same file on the different machines.

    The site seems to be working fine when I try it in IE and Firefox. However in Chrome I am getting this on the contact page. I am running windows 7 64bit - could this be an isolated compatibility issue with chrome 32bit and windows 64bit?

    This is a browser cache issue, press CTRL+F5 to reload a fresh copy from the server.

    WD6 uses the exact same protocol as FileZilla. So if you can connect and upload via FZ then the same details will work with WD6.
    Please post a screenshot of the publishing tab with your details entered (the password will be masked, so it's safe to do so) - it's likely that something is being entered incorrectly.
